Montana state flower

Kim Klassen - Stained Linen

I used kim klassen's texture pourous a different way.  the photo itself has no texture on it.  the very edges are dark only becuase the layer has texture layer has been multiplied and altered.  I used pourous for the background resizing so it would be a 4 x 6 then added teh photo and text.  then went back and added it again and as you can see used the multiply mode and took away some so it had some dark edges.
